An epic simile, also known as a Homeric simile, is a literary device that utilizes an extended and elaborate comparison between two seemingly disparate objects or events. This type of simile is often found in epic poetry, where they serve to embellish the narrative and provide readers with a vivid mental image of the events being described. Some synonyms for the term "epic simile" include extended metaphor, elaborate comparison, elaborate metaphor, grandiose comparison, and heroic comparison. Each of these terms is used to describe a literary technique that employs a detailed and complex comparison between diverse objects or events.
